首页
学习
活动
专区
工具
TVP
发布

日本NHK推出人工智能主,可模拟真人主声音播报新闻 | 黑科技

人工智能“新闻主Yomiko”将模拟真人主声音播报记者写成的新闻稿件。 人工智能技术的出现,为很多行业都带来了便利,同时也使人类前所未有的感受到了压力。“人工智能将取代哪些行业的人员?”...近日,据外媒报道,日本NHK电视台将从4月开始在节目中使用人工智能主,该“主”将在工作日晚间11时10分播出的“NEWSCHECK11”节目中登场,每周播报一次约5分钟的新闻。...据了解,该人工智能新闻主名叫“Yomiko”,其将模拟真人主声音播报记者写成的新闻稿件。技术人员只需事先让NHK旗下的主阅读大量新闻稿件并录音,然后将这些语音数据分解为10万个音素。...此次,推出人工智能主,可以说是一次巨大的突破。 不过,Yomiko目前仅局限于播报新闻,我们也期待未来Yomiko能有更多突破。

53840
您找到你想要的搜索结果了吗?
是的
没有找到

5分钟就能让自己变成主,科大讯飞上线声音复刻功能

合成林志玲和特朗普的声音等视频也获得大量播放。语音合成有什么用处呢?除了智能语音客服等应用,其实语音合成已经渗透进我们的生活。...近日,科大讯飞终于通过微博账号“讯飞有声”宣布,讯飞有声APP开放语音合成功能,名为“我的个人主”,通俗讲就是声音复刻。 ?...按照官方介绍,用户用自己的声音读完一段小故事,稍等约5分钟就能让自己变成主,不过这一功能上线仅两天就吸引了大量用户尝鲜,目前排队的用户过多,时间会相应增长几分钟,合成完毕后会有短信提醒。 ?...通过体验我们得知,用户复刻声音后,在讯飞有声APP中可以收听官方推送的早报、快讯、任意公众号的文章,甚至本地文档。...从实际合成效果来看,音色还原度很高,词语连贯程度在可以接受的范围内,不过由于录制环境并不理想,最终的声音会带有部分环境噪音。如果广大用户想尝鲜,需要找一个相对安静的环境。

6.2K20

多功能流媒体播放器实现网页无插件直播之EasyPlayer.js如何实现播放完自动循环播放

EasyPlayer-Android播放器是一款可针对RTSP、RTMP、RTSP&RTMP协议进行过优化的流媒体播放器,其中我们引以为傲的两个技术优势就是起速度快和播放延迟低。...EasyPlayer.js如何实现播放完自动循环播放? 分析问题: H5中video标签支持自动循环播放。...Video.js 是一个通用的在网页上嵌入视频播放器的 JS 库,Video.js 自动检测浏览器对 HTML5 的支持情况,如果不支持 HTML5 则自动使用 Flash 播放器。...Video.js实例化video时添加属性。 解决问题: 在video.js实例化video标签时添加loop此属性就可以实现播放完自动循环播放。...目前支持Windows、 Android、iOS三个平台,同时EasyPlayer.js还支持Linux平台。

4.3K10

直播全流程探索

、话筒录制主的直播画面 以及OBS等录屏软件录制游戏界面并合成直播画面; 4.户外直播,目前户外直播也比较流行,类似于真人秀的模式,主主要依赖手机自带摄像头和话筒来录制内容; 5.手游直播,比如最近很火的王者荣耀...对于采集到的视频内容,需要做一些后期处理,主要包括两个方面: (1)对于录制好的视频画面可能达不到主满意,还有一些主想要加一些特效,需要对内容做美颜、磨皮、滤镜、加特效等处理,这个处理过程涉及到复杂的运算...,运用到人脸识别、视频合成等方面的技术; (2)有一些视频有版权方面的限制,需要加注水印,可以在这个环节处理,后面的转码阶段处理也可以; DIY音频处理 (1)原始声音可能比较杂,需要做降噪处理; (2...)有一些直播场景,主有一些混音、变音的处理,声音特效也是在这个环节处理; 编码处理 编码处理实际就是视频压缩处理的过程。...这里的分片长度和列表数量反应了时延长度,比如列表长度为5,分片时长为9s,则整个时延为45s; 3 播放终端解析m3u8的播放列表,依照顺序获取ts数据流,播放完毕的时候拉取下一个; ?

5.3K80

模拟制作网易云音乐(AudioContext)

看着自己洋洋洒洒写了快1000多行的js,我现在心里也是一万屁草泥马飘过。当然其中还有很多代码没有经过提炼,很多变量可以公用,用对象化的方式来说写这个会更有条理,这个博主以后有时间再梳理一遍。...二、具体分析 2.1 路由 routes/index.js router.get('/', function(req, res, next) { fs.readdir(media, function...播放其实是一个非常简单的API,直接调用BufferSourceNode的start方法即可,start方法有两个我们会用到的参数,第一个是开始时间,第二个是时间位移,决定了我们从什么时候开始,这将在跳的时候会用到.../** * 播放完成后的回调 * @return null */ function onPlayEnded() { var acState = ac.state; // 在进行上一曲和下一曲或者跳跃播放的时候...最开始加载音频的时候,AudioContext默认的状态是suspended,这也是我最开始最纳闷的事,当我点击播放按钮的时候没有声音,而点击跳的时候会播放声音,后来调试发现走到了resumeAudio

2K50

替换谷歌原生音频播放器的最佳方案

原生的播放器,功能不够强大,而且会有一些局限性就会导致无法实现我们的功能 今天大师兄就给大家介绍一款优秀的音频库howler.js howler.js howler.js是现代网络的音频库。...特点 howler.js不仅有诸多特点,而且还兼容了许多旧版本 满足所有音频需求的单一 API 默认为 Web 音频 API 并回退到 HTML5 音频 跨环境处理边缘情况和错误 支持所有编解码器以提供完整的跨浏览器支持...自动缓存以提高性能 单独、分组或全局控制声音 一次播放多个声音 简单的声音精灵定义和播放 完全控制衰落、速率、搜索、音量等。...轻松添加 3D 空间声音或立体声声像 模块化 - 使用您想要的并且易于扩展 没有外部依赖,只有纯 JavaScript 轻至 7kb 压缩包 安装 使用npm安装 npm install howler...sound.webm', 'sound.mp3'] }); // 第一次调用后清除侦听器 sound.once('load', function(){ sound.play(); }); // 声音放完毕时触发

1.9K20

Vue3开发:视频播放器video.js使用详解

前言 Video.js是一个通用的在网页上嵌入视频播放器的JS库,比原生video标签有更强大的功能、更好的兼容性、更美观等优点。...安装使用 首先安装video.js: pnpm install video.js --save 然后引入css,在mian.js中: import "video.js/dist/video-js.css...(url); player.on("ended", () => {//播放完成}) 即可播放。...因为浏览器实际上是不允许自动播放声音,所以静音后自动播放基本不会失效,但是没有声音需要自己处理一下。 “play”:自动播放,与true效果一样。...所有事件大家可以查阅官网https://docs.videojs.com/player canplay:视频可以播放 playing:播放 pause:暂停 timeupdate:播放进度更新 ended:播放完

3.2K30

【短视频运营】抖音推送机制 | 账号 “ 完率 “ 数据

文章目录 一、抖音推送机制 二、账号 " 完率 " 数据 一、抖音推送机制 ---- 抖音推送机制 : 初始分发阶段 : 每个新账号都会自动分配 1 万的 初始分发 流量 , 大约 200 ~...进而转为粉丝 ; 如 : 智能电子乐器 相关的 垂直账号 , 需要的特定用户是 音乐爱好者群体 ; 流量池 : 第一阶段 流量池 获得好的数据 , 系统才会将 作品 向下一级 流量池推荐 ; 二、账号 " 完率..." 数据 ---- 完率 : 完率本质是 用户在视频上的 停留时长 ; 如果用户 一直播放 该账号下的视频 , 或者 反复播放某一个视频 , 完率会很高 ; 完率 不只是 将视频播放完毕 ,...如果 视频很短如几秒 , 很快就播放完毕 , 实际上 完率 这项数据并不高 ; 提高 " 完率 " 的技巧 : ① 黄金三秒 : 视频的开始 3 秒很重要 , 开始的几秒钟如果不够精彩 , 用户会立刻刷走该视频

1.5K11

iOS开发之多媒体API (转载)

放完成需要把播放视图remove这样才可以获得上一个屏幕。...高级API,易用 System Sound API –播放短声音、警告音等。 AVFoundation 可以播放长时间声音,简单易用。...12.2.3 System Sound API System Sound 可以播放“短的”声音,所谓短声音就是5秒以内。 不循环、没有声音控制、立即播放。...播放格式限制: 线性PCM 和 IMA4 .caf .aif 或 .wav 播放“短声音” 播放“短声音”主要就是两个步骤: 注册声音 AudioServicesCreateSystemSoundID ...AVAudioPlayer音频播放类,用于播放大于5秒钟声音,可以播放本地声音,但是不能播放网络媒体文件。能够播放、 暂停、循环和跳过等操作。 AVAudioRecorder音频录制类。

1.2K20

TRTC学习之旅(四)-- 用electron实现视频聊天室

pack:win64 打包 Windows 64 位的 .exe 安装文件 开启开发者工具 在官方给的demo中,electron是默认没有打开开发者工具的,我们需要在main.electron.js...// 有摄像头,没有麦克风,可以视频 if (trtcState.isMicReady() === false) { this.warn('找不到可用的麦克风,观众将无法听到您的声音...在计算签名之前,需要先在src\debug\gen-test-user-sig.js设置好自己应用的sdkAppId和秘钥 image.png 设置好之后,通过调用ge-test-user-sig.js...TRTCAppSceneLIVE:视频互动直播,支持平滑上下麦,切换过程无需等待,主延时小于300ms;支持十万级别观众同时播放,播放延时低至1000ms。...待资源释放完毕,SDK 会通过 TRTCCallback 中的 onExitRoom() 回调通知。

4.4K30

嵌入式linux下如何尽快播放开机音乐

今天在考虑如何尽快启动一个应用程序,个开机音乐什么的。.../zqbMusic kaiji.wav 那么就在五秒多的时候,开始播放,播放完毕六秒多,打印出了"/ #",这样就比较不好了,我“/ #”之后还要启动其他应用程序呢,放音乐直接延迟了其他事情一秒多。...这么做了之后,好一些了,五秒多就可以听到声音了,打印“/ #”的时间也在五秒多(比原来慢一些,毕竟多跑了个线程抢资源) 这个时候,忍不住就要想,能不能再往前提,我干脆提到跟init并行,不改文件系统的话.../kaiji.wav",NULL); return 0; } 搞好Makefile,编译出zqbinit,放进去,这回可以用了 结果是,音乐在四秒多就开始了,原本的init也能正常执行下去最终到达控制台

1.6K10

html5视频常用API接口「建议收藏」

autoplay autoplay 设置是否打开浏览器后自动播放 width Pilex(像素) 设置播放器的宽度 height Pilex(像素) 设置播放器的高度 loop loop 设置视频是否循环播放(即播放完后继续重新播放...label="中文" srclang="zh" kind="subtitles" default/> 二、.video标签API方法:Video标签也提供了比较人性化的API接口方法,供写JS...videoid.canPlayType(‘video/mp4’); 判断浏览器是否支持当前类型的视频格式 返回值: 空字符串:不支持 Maybe:可能支持 Probably:完全支持 关于video标签的API接口在JS...probably(支持) 45 } 46 47 48 三、video标签API属性: Video不仅提供了API接口,还提供了许多的API属性,方便在JS...autoplay 媒体加载后自动播放 buffered 返回缓冲部件的时间范围(TimeRanges对象) controller 返回当前的媒体控制器(MediaController对象) controls 显示控控件

3.8K20
领券